counter Swimming great Leisel Jones reveals three words that kept her alive when she wanted to ‘end it all’ – Forsething

Swimming great Leisel Jones reveals three words that kept her alive when she wanted to ‘end it all’

The three-time Olympic Gold medal winner has shared the three powerful words that kept her alive when she contemplated ending her own life just days ago.

About admin